Briefing: Leadership Review — Budget Request

Finance team: Corven Analytics requests an additional 1.4M for the Larkspur platform build. Headcount: four engineers, one analyst. Offset proposed via deferral of the Melwick refresh. Payback modelled at 19 months. Risks: vendor pricing and delayed onboarding. Decision needed before the quarter close. The confidential note below sets out the underlying business plans.

board note of tajef-yagep: Tamaxix Partners plans to raise the Gorael list price by 38 percent in January.

## Deployment

The Bramblekit Swift and Kotlin SDKs ship from a single parity manifest. Do not tag a release unless the parity report shows zero divergent endpoints; offline-sync and retry semantics must match exactly. Build both artifacts from the same commit, run the cross-SDK contract suite, then promote to the staging channel for 24 hours before general release. Rollbacks revert both SDKs together, never one alone. The release pipeline applies these values.

service settings:
PRAIX_LOG_LEVEL=error
PRAIX_METRICS_HOST=metrics.praix.qorvelcorp.corp
PRAIX_POOL_SIZE=16

ALERT: fabrikforge-testdata — factory drift detected. The Fabrikforge test-data factory library is emitting records that no longer match the Ledgerpond v9 schema; 14 factories affected, CI fixtures failing on main. Reviewers: block merges that add new factories until the schema pin is bumped. Do not hand-edit generated fixtures. Root cause appears to be the unpinned schema dependency introduced last sprint. Triage owner rotates weekly. Remediation steps, affected factory list, and the current schema pin are tracked on the internal page here.

wiki page, tahaf-tajog: https://jira.ordindyn.corp/pipeline

**Day One Checklist — Facilities Desk, Brellint House**

☐ Lift maintenance heads-up: every weekend, the Kesterman crew takes Lifts 2 and 3 offline from Saturday morning through Sunday noon. Pop the signage out Friday before you leave — it lives in the cupboard behind the desk. If anyone grumbles, point them to Lift 1 or the east stairwell. You'll need to let the engineers through the service door on Level B, so keep the pass handy. Here's the code you'll use:

turnstile pass: bdg-TXR-4